Operating hours have been extended throughout July, August, and September at all four Walt Disney World theme parks.
Magic Kingdom
From August 1 through August 9, Magic Kingdom will be opening at 9:00 AM and closing at 10:00 PM, instead of 9:00 PM.
EPCOT
On August 1, 6-8, 13-15, 20-22, and 27-29, EPCOT will also close at 10:00 PM instead of 9:00 PM. It will still open at 11:00 AM.
Disney’s Hollywood Studios
Disney’s Hollywood Studios will be closing at 9:00 PM instead of 8:00 PM from August 29 through September 10, September 12 through 14, and September 16 through 25. It will still open at 9:00 AM.
Disney’s Animal Kingdom
Disney’s Animal Kingdom will continue to open at 8:00 AM. It will close at 8:00 PM from July 26 through July 30. It will close at 7:00 PM from August 1 through September 25.
The Orange County Sheriff Office responded to a “marine crash” at 9:41 AM, reportedly involving the General Joe Potter ferryboat at Walt Disney World.
The ferryboat, which transports guests between Magic Kingdom and the Transportation and Ticket Center, is currently unavailable for service and is docked at Magic Kingdom. There is no visible damage, and it’s unclear if there were any injuries or what exactly the boat crashed into.
After the incident, it seems the General Joe Potter was taken backstage as we only witnessed the Admiral Joe Fowler and Richard F. Irvine setting sail.
Bill Farmer, the voice of Goofy, has revealed that the classic character will be among the Disney Fab 50 statues coming to Walt Disney World for the resort’s 50th anniversary.
According to Farmer, Goofy’s statue will be at Magic Kingdom.
These 50 statues will be found throughout Walt Disney World starting October 1. Mickey’s statue was revealed two days ago, and we know from the original rendering that Minnie will be among the 50 characters as well.

With the return of fireworks to the parks earlier this month, even more magic is back. planDisney has revealed that fireworks cruises are available once again at Walt Disney World Resort.
You can book a private fireworks cruise to enjoy EPCOT Forever from the World Showcase Lagoon, or Happily Ever After from the Seven Seas Lagoon or Bay Lake. To book a fireworks cruise, you must call Disney at (407) WDW-PLAY.
Each cruise can accommodate up to 10 guests, and prices start at $399 before tax. Assorted snacks and soft drinks are provided, and you can request complimentary festive banners and balloons when booking. And don’t worry, you won’t miss any of the magic — synchronized audio will play onboard.
